About HSH Group / The Peninsula Hong Kong

The Hongkong and Shanghai Hotels, Limited (HSH) is a distinguished luxury hospitality and real estate group established in 1866 and list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ange. Renowned for its flagship property, The Peninsula Hong Kong, HSH has expanded its portfolio to include twelve prestigious hotels under The Peninsula brand.

These hotels are strategically located in major cities across Asia, Europe, and the United States.

Property Portfolio

In addition to its hotel operations, HSH manages a diverse array of commercial and residential properties, enhancing its presence in key markets.

Notable assets include:

  • The Repulse Bay
  • The Peak Tower
  • The Peninsula Office Tower in Hong Kong
  • The Landmark in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am

Additional Ventures

HSH's commitment to excellence extends beyond hospitality and real estate. The company owns and operates The Peak Tram, a historic funicular railway in Hong Kong.

It also offers club management services through Peninsula Clubs and Consultancy Services, underscoring HSH's dedication to providing comprehensive luxury experiences to its clientele.
